Will sex be part of heaven?

what does the bible say?The Bible does not mention sex being part of heaven. In Matthew 22:23-33, Jesus explains that there will be no marriage or giving in marriage in the resurrection, which implies that sex will not exist in heaven. In Hinduism, what is an avatar? Was Jesus an avatar?

what does the bible say?The Hindu concept of avatars and the biblical teaching about Jesus differ significantly. An avatar in Hinduism is a temporary, earthly manifestation of a god, often seen as part of a cyclical process. What are the seven seals, trumpets, and bowls in Revelation?

what does the bible say?Revelation describes three series of seven judgments during the tribulation: the seals, trumpets, and bowls. The seven seals include the Four Horsemen, martyrdom, and natural disasters; the seventh seal leads to the trumpets. Christian Eschatology - What is it?

what does the bible say?Eschatology is the study of last things. It comes from the Greek word eschaton, referring to the end, or last things. In Christian theology, the term "eschatology" specifically focuses on the study of the prophecies of the Bible, primarily those prophecies that are yet unfulfilled.
